Ingredients

Teabag tea biscuits

  • 125 g softened butter
  • 55 g caster sugar
  • 1 egg yolk
  • 150 g plain flour
  • 35 g Corn Flour
  • 1 tsp Earl Grey tea
  • 1 tbsp Vanilla Bean Paste
  • 100 g chocolate, Dark or milk, melted

Recipe's preparation

    Teabag tea biscuits
  1. 1.place butter and caster sugar into bowl and cream for 20sec, spd 5. Scrape down sides.
    2. add egg yolk and blend 5 sec, spd 5
    3. add remaining ingredients and mix 10sec, spd 5
    4. select dough setting, knead mix 1min 30sec
    5. turn out mix onto cling wrap, roll into a ball and chill in fridge 30mins
    6. heat oven 160degrees
    7. roll out mix and slice into teabag size rectangles
    8. using a straw or skewer make a hole at the top of each biscuit
    9. bake in oven 15mins or until lightly golden
    10. cool 30mins and then dip bottom half of each biscuit into melted chocolate
    11. decorate with ribbon or thread and a paper msg tag
